WHAT IS THE ALTERNATOR:-

• Synchronous generator or basically case machine and

or usually called alternators rotating machine.

• A Alternator is a machine for converting mechanical

power from a rime mover to A.C. electric power at a

specific voltage and frequency.

THREE PHASE ALTERNATOR-

A three phase stator can also be connected so that the phase form a delta connection.

In the delta connection the line voltage are equal to the phase voltage but the line c/n will be equal to the vector sum of the phase c/n.

ADVANTAGES OF ALTERNATOR-

• Most alternator have the rotating field and the stationary armature.

• This generated voltage may be high as 33 kv.

• The armature windings being station ary are not subjected do vibration & centrifugal forces.

• The armature of large alternators are forced with circulating gas or liquids.
